传奇什么数据库好用

fiy 其他 5

回复

共3条回复 我来回复
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    传奇是一款非常受欢迎的网络游戏,对于数据库的选择来说,有几个常见的选择:

    1. MySQL:MySQL是一种开源的关系型数据库管理系统,被广泛应用于传奇游戏中。它具有良好的性能和稳定性,并且支持大规模的数据存储和高并发访问。MySQL还提供了完善的安全机制和管理工具,可以方便地进行数据备份和恢复。

    2. PostgreSQL:PostgreSQL是另一种开源的关系型数据库管理系统,也是传奇游戏中常用的数据库之一。它具有强大的功能和灵活的架构,支持复杂的查询和高级数据类型。PostgreSQL还提供了高级的事务管理和并发控制机制,可以保证数据的一致性和可靠性。

    3. MongoDB:MongoDB是一种面向文档的NoSQL数据库,适用于存储和处理大量的非结构化数据。对于一些需要处理大量玩家数据和游戏日志的传奇游戏来说,MongoDB可以提供高性能和可扩展性。它还具有灵活的数据模型和强大的查询功能,可以方便地进行数据分析和统计。

    综上所述,对于传奇游戏来说,MySQL、PostgreSQL和MongoDB是比较好用的数据库选择。选择适合自己需求的数据库,能够提供高性能、可靠性和灵活性,满足游戏的需求。

    1年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    在选择使用哪种数据库时,"传奇"这个词可能指的是游戏,所以我将提供一些适合游戏开发的数据库。

    1. MySQL:MySQL是一种开源关系型数据库管理系统,广泛用于游戏开发。它具有良好的性能和可靠性,并且支持多种编程语言。MySQL易于安装和使用,并且具有强大的功能,如事务处理和复制。

    2. PostgreSQL:PostgreSQL也是一种开源关系型数据库管理系统,被广泛用于游戏开发。它具有高度可扩展性和可靠性,并支持复杂的数据类型和查询。PostgreSQL还具有强大的事务处理和并发控制功能。

    3. MongoDB:MongoDB是一种面向文档的NoSQL数据库,适用于游戏开发。它存储数据以文档的形式,可以轻松地处理复杂的数据结构和嵌套关系。MongoDB还具有水平扩展性和高性能的特点,适合处理大规模的游戏数据。

    4. Redis:Redis是一种内存数据存储系统,广泛用于游戏开发。它提供了快速的读写速度,并支持多种数据结构,如字符串、哈希表和有序集合。Redis还具有发布/订阅功能,可以用于实时游戏通信和缓存管理。

    5. Amazon DynamoDB:Amazon DynamoDB是一种托管的NoSQL数据库,适用于游戏开发。它提供了自动扩展和高可用性,适用于处理大规模的游戏数据。DynamoDB还提供了灵活的数据模型和强大的查询功能。

    在选择数据库时,还应考虑到游戏的需求和预算。不同的数据库有不同的特点和定价模型,开发人员应根据项目的具体要求选择合适的数据库。

    1年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    在选择适合的数据库时,需要根据具体的需求来考虑。以下是几种常见的传奇游戏数据库以及它们的特点和优势。

    1. MySQL
      MySQL 是一种开源的关系型数据库管理系统,被广泛应用于各种应用程序中。它具有以下特点:
    • 开源免费:MySQL 是免费提供的,可以节省成本。
    • 可靠性:MySQL 提供了高可靠性和稳定性,能够处理大量的并发请求。
    • 可扩展性:MySQL 支持水平和垂直扩展,可以根据需要进行扩展。
    • 大数据处理能力:MySQL 可以处理海量数据,并提供高效的查询和索引机制。
    1. PostgreSQL
      PostgreSQL 是一种开源的关系型数据库管理系统,被广泛应用于各种企业级应用程序中。它具有以下特点:
    • 可扩展性:PostgreSQL 支持水平和垂直扩展,可以根据需要进行扩展。
    • 高级特性:PostgreSQL 提供了许多高级特性,如事务处理、并发控制、触发器等。
    • 可靠性:PostgreSQL 具有高可靠性和稳定性,能够处理大量的并发请求。
    • 外部扩展:PostgreSQL 支持外部扩展,可以通过插件的方式增加额外的功能。
    1. MongoDB
      MongoDB 是一种开源的文档型数据库,被广泛应用于大数据和实时分析等领域。它具有以下特点:
    • 高性能:MongoDB 使用内存映射文件的方式,能够快速读写数据。
    • 可扩展性:MongoDB 支持水平扩展,可以根据需要进行扩展。
    • 弹性存储:MongoDB 使用 BSON(二进制 JSON)格式存储数据,支持灵活的数据结构。
    • 复制和故障转移:MongoDB 支持复制和故障转移,保证数据的可用性和可靠性。
    1. Redis
      Redis 是一种开源的键值对存储系统,被广泛应用于缓存、消息队列等场景。它具有以下特点:
    • 高性能:Redis 使用内存存储数据,并且支持持久化,能够快速读写数据。
    • 数据类型丰富:Redis 支持多种数据类型,如字符串、哈希、列表、集合等。
    • 发布订阅机制:Redis 支持发布订阅机制,可以实现实时消息传递。
    • 分布式缓存:Redis 支持分布式缓存,可以提高应用程序的性能和可扩展性。

    综上所述,选择适合的数据库需要考虑到具体的需求和场景。如果需要一个稳定、可靠、高性能的数据库,可以考虑 MySQL 或 PostgreSQL;如果需要处理大数据和实时分析,可以考虑 MongoDB;如果需要缓存和消息队列,可以考虑 Redis。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部